Soba (Cold)

This is the best way to eat soba in the sweltering summer heat. Grated radish makes you feel so refreshed when it is hot. I recommend making it for a light snack.

Yield: 2 servings
Time: 15 minutes



Ingredients

  • 2 bundles of soba noodles
  • 1/2 cup grated radish (daikon)
  • 1/4 cup of green onion
Spices
  • 1 tsp hondashi
  • 1/4 cup soy sauce
  • 1/4 cup mirin
Preparation
  1. Mix spices and one cup of water and boil, remove from heat and cool
  2. Boil Soba noodles for 8 minutes, rinse with cold water and strain.
    (Each type of soba has different boil time, so please follow the instructions on the package)
  3. Put the noodle in the bowl, add some ice, sprinkle radish on the soba, then pour in the sauce
